How AC gauges work
An AC gauge set has two main gauges. One reads low-side (suction) pressure. The other reads high-side (discharge) pressure. Hoses connect the gauges to service ports on the system. The gauges convert pressure to units you can read, like psi or bar. If you wonder "What is an AC gauge used for?" remember: it turns hidden pressures into clear numbers you can act on. Gauges also help tie pressure to temperature via refrigerant charts. That link tells you if the refrigerant is overcharged, low, or operating at the proper temperatures.

When and why to use an AC gauge
You use an AC gauge to:
- Check system charge
- Low pressure often means low refrigerant. High pressure can mean a restriction or overcharge.
- Find leaks or blockages
- A big pressure drop on the low side can point to a leak or failed compressor.
- Verify performance after repair
- A correct pressure pattern shows the system is working as designed.

Interpreting readings and common pressure patterns
A few simple patterns help you diagnose problems fast.
- Both low and high pressures low
- Likely undercharge or weak compressor.
- Low-side low and high-side high
- Could indicate a restriction like a blocked expansion device.
- Low-side near suction temp and high-side very high
- Possible overcharge or heat load problem.

Precautions, limitations, and safety
An AC gauge is powerful, but not perfect. Know the limits.
- Gauges show pressure, not exact refrigerant mass.
- Pressure alone may not reveal oil level or internal wear.
- Readings change with ambient temperature.
- Always note outdoor and indoor temps when diagnosing.
- Handling refrigerants requires certification in many places.
- Follow laws and safety practices.

Personal tips and common mistakes to avoid
From years on the job, here are short tips you can use.
- Always purge hoses before connecting to avoid air contamination.
- Use correct fittings to avoid leaks or cross-contamination.
- Take time to stabilize the system before reading gauges.
- Log readings and ambient conditions for future reference.
- If unsure, consult a certified technician rather than guessing.
